    FIFA President Infantino Faces Possible No-Confidence Vote by Major Football Bodies

    In a significant development within international football governance, leading regional confederations UEFA, AFC, and CONCACAF are reportedly considering a no-confidence vote against FIFA President Gianni Infantino. This move reflects mounting dissatisfaction with Infantino’s leadership style and decisions since he assumed office in 2016. The potential vote signals deepening divisions among football’s global administrative bodies, which could impact FIFA’s future direction and policies.

    Gianni Infantino has overseen several controversial changes during his tenure, including expanding the World Cup format and managing the organization’s response to corruption scandals. UEFA, representing European football, AFC from Asia, and CONCACAF covering North and Central America, collectively wield significant influence in FIFA’s governance structure. Their united stance against Infantino could challenge his authority and prompt calls for reforms within the sport’s highest governing body.

    The implications of this no-confidence consideration extend beyond FIFA’s internal politics, potentially affecting global football operations, tournament planning, and international cooperation. Should these regional bodies proceed with the vote, it may trigger a leadership crisis or force negotiations to address concerns raised by member associations. This situation underscores the ongoing tensions in football administration and the critical role of regional confederations in shaping the sport’s future.
